The Influence of Temperature on Paint Application
When you're planning a business exterior painting task, the temperature level can considerably influence how well the paint sticks and dries out.
Preferably, you wish to paint when temperature levels range between 50 ° F and 85 ° F. If it's as well cool, the paint may not cure effectively, bring about issues like peeling or cracking.
On the other hand, if it's as well warm, the paint can dry out as well rapidly, stopping proper bond and causing an unequal finish.
You ought to likewise take into consideration the moment of day; early morning or late afternoon provides cooler temperature levels, which can be a lot more favorable.
Always check the maker's recommendations for the specific paint you're using, as they commonly provide support on the perfect temperature level array for optimum results.
Humidity and Its Impact on Drying Times
Temperature isn't the only ecological variable that affects your industrial outside painting job; moisture plays a substantial function too. High humidity degrees can reduce drying times dramatically, impacting the overall high quality of your paint job.
When the air is saturated with wetness, the paint takes longer to treat, which can result in concerns like bad bond and a greater danger of mildew growth. If you're repainting on a particularly humid day, be gotten ready for extensive delay times in between coats.
It's essential to check neighborhood weather and plan accordingly. Ideally, go for moisture degrees between 40% and 70% for optimal drying out.

Best Seasons for Commercial Outside Paint Projects
What's the best time of year for your business outside painting jobs?
Springtime and early loss are generally your best choices. During these seasons, temperature levels are light, and humidity degrees are often reduced, creating ideal conditions for paint application and drying out.
Prevent summer's intense heat, which can create paint to completely dry too quickly, causing poor adhesion and surface. Similarly, winter's cold temperature levels can prevent proper drying out and curing, taking the chance of the longevity of your paint job.
